NSSpellChecker and learning words.


  • Subject: NSSpellChecker and learning words.
  • From: Óscar Morales Vivó <email@hidden>
  • Date: Tue, 1 Nov 2005 15:40:53 -0500

I'm trying to add Cocoa spellchecker support to a Carbon app that supports Panther (the sample code has been real helpful there). However since I cannot use the spellchecking panel, I need to do everything by hand.

That in itself doesn't seem to be a problem, except for having words added to the user's learnt words dictionary. Adding words to ignore is easy enough, but there seems to be no method in NSSpellChecker to add a word to the list of a language's learnt words.

Am I looking in the wrong place for that or is that not possible without using the spellchecking panel?
